Output 70926b514f7cc7d7b007a391e388d5624d278fcd5a3fc3da8e23d59dd90823bd:0

value
12577735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91a8b670317158841467ff768f9240fd2892fc95 OP_EQUALVERIFY OP_CHECKSIG
address
1EHB6BCPiPL22YfNPUevbz8SzqjYpHEzYo
transaction
70926b514f7cc7d7b007a391e388d5624d278fcd5a3fc3da8e23d59dd90823bd
spent
true